Developing a 600-watt RMS 8" woofer with fully custom frame, cone, surround, spider, etc... Frame supports ~35mm one-way linear travel and the soft parts support that as well. Design is motor limited to 19mm linear one-way and 30mm before leaving the gap -- so it will be VERY difficult to reach mechanical limitations even by accident on SPL burps. Well some peeps sent me up a nightshade to play with (Thanks Travis and Eric!!) well on with my results thus far. Box is my standard "scrapy" box, 2.7 cu ft with one 6" aero tuned to about 39 hz where my car peaks at 42 hz. Car is a 1997 Chevy Cavalier z24 I have 1 yellow top battery under hood and one kinetic in the trunk. the results are: dB drag: 148.3 bass race: 147.3 Midwest spl: 149.5, 149.3 on video Usaci: 150.6 Street beat: 149.2 Now i have an saz-3500 to throw on it, we will see how far this jumps
